Question is that: I'm curious about taking a one-level dip into the Titan Fighter to used Oversized Two-handed weapons. However, there are a few people pointing out that its not plausable because the Titan Fighter was effected by the Titan Mauler's Errata - stating that any Medium Character CANNOT wield 2-handed weapons that are oversized for them.
Considering that the Titan Fighter archetype for the Fighter trades both their Level 1 Bonus Feat and their Armor Training for abilities that specifically call out on "Oversized 2-handed weapons", was this archetype missed by the Errata team and now a dead Archetype? There haven't been any changes made to this Archetype in any of the books, and no official announcements on changes as far as I've seen. Eh? Both titan maulers and titan fighters can wield two-handed weapons for creatures larger than their size. It's right there in the ability descriptions (post-errata, for titan mauler). I'm not sure I understand the objection.

i believe the confusion is that there was a FAQ that said Titan Maulers could not wield two-handed weapons for creatures larger than their size because it originally didn't say they could. i believe Titan Fighter always had this language, though, and since then, there has been an errata adding it to Titan Maulers as well.
